I have a question, I'm about 9 weeks out and I'm wondering if I can have any carbs at all with a meal? I found some low carb soft tortilla that would be great to use as Buns for a turkey sandwich. They only have 5 net carbs and with as little as I eat i would only have about a 1/3 of it anyways. I just feel guilty thinking about eating it though. Anyone have any thoughts?

I certainly did, and it didn't bother my weight loss. Some people are heavily into the low carb thing and have a firm belief that they are bad and should be avoided. This is basically a mirror image of the low fat diets of yesteryear. Unless you have a specific morbidity such as diabetes or insulin resistance and have been told to avoid carbohydrates by your medical team, go ahead and have a healthy diet (which includes some carbohydrates...) as long as your calories are still under control.

I occasionally used a thin corn tortilla, crisped in the oven, as a mini-pizza crust. After about four months, I needed to specifically add some complex carbohydrates tactically into my diet for energy management purposes.

I eat carbs. I'm usually in the 50 - 70 range per day. I try to get most of them from fruits/veggies, but I do occasionally have a low-carb tortilla or one ounce of potatoes or rice. I can't really eat bread now (it sits like a rock in my tummy), but that's ok.

I think many plans advocate low-carb because a lot of carbs are slider foods, or they don't offer as much nutrition for the calories you are consuming. Some people are extremely carb sensitive, too, but I have always felt better with a balance of carbs, fats, and Protein.
